BREAKING: Yoruba Nation Awareness Campaign Starts In Lagos

A campaign to create awareness for Yoruba nation is currently going on In Agege area of Lagos.
This is coming after popular Yoruba activist, Sunday Igboho declared that Yoruba doesn’t want to be part of Nigeria again, but want to stand alone.
For this reason, several others have risen up to support this movement, and the campaign is one of those ways to support the Yoruba nation movement.
